- [ ] Step 7: Archive cold storage buckets (Glacierline tier). Confirm both ceremony witnesses are present, verify bucket manifests match the Oxbow ledger, then seal the archive key shares. Plugin authors may observe but not handle shares. Once sealed, the archive index itself is encrypted and can only be reopened with the passphrase below.

vault phrase of badup-hahig = tamael-aldael-kelmir-istael-fenok-istwyn-tamius-jorath-oliion

- [ ] **Step 7: Breaker override escrow.** After sealing the signing keys for the Tallgrove upstream API circuit breaker, confirm the support team can force the breaker open during a full outage. The override bundle lives in the sealed escrow drawer and is useless without its unlock phrase. Two ceremony witnesses must initial this step before proceeding. The escrow bundle is decrypted with the recovery passphrase that follows.

vault phrase of kahip-kahop = holath-quenmir

Ticket: Vault locked — Emberlink firmware channel

The secrets vault gating the Emberlink device-firmware update channel auto-locked after three failed unseal attempts during last night's rotation. Updates are queued, not lost. Future maintainers: verify the rotation script's retry backoff before unsealing. To unlock the vault, enter the passphrase below.

recovery phrase for bawep-kawef: oliath-casdor